Emmerdale‘s Sarah Sugden and her new love interest Kammy Hadiq will be fired from the garage in upcoming scenes, after getting into some drama with a customer.
Sarah has recently been getting to know village newcomer Kammy, after Jacob Gallagher dumped her last month.
In scenes set to air on Friday (April 4), Sarah continues to enjoy spending time with Kammy, who has been offered a trial at the garage.
Continuing to embrace her inner Dingle, Sarah offers Kammy a joyride in a customer’s sports car that’s in for servicing.
Although Kammy refuses, the customer comes over and accuses him of scratching the car.
Sarah is furious when Cain refuses to back Kammy up, with the argument ultimately resulting in the customer terminating his contract with the garage.
Cain is furious about the situation and fires both Sarah and Kammy. How will Sarah’s grandmother Charity react when she finds out about Cain’s decision?
Elsewhere next week, Jacob faces fresh heartbreak as he realises that he may have missed his chance with Sarah, who he dumped while grieving his late mum Leyla following the devastating limo crash.
Jacob regrets ending the relationship and turns up at the garage in the hopes of talking things through, but Sarah stands firm and insists that she isn’t interested any more.
Katie Hill, who plays Sarah, recently teased the possibility of Jacob and Kammy going head-to-head for her character’s affections.
“I think that will definitely be on the cards,” she said. “It’s funny as well because they’re so different. Kammy’s a bit of a bad boy. He’s a bit of a cheeky chap.
“Jacob, you know, he’s a trainee doctor, way more sensible than Kammy is. So it’ll be interesting to see which way she goes.”
